Benefits Of Conducting A Furnace Heat Exchanger Test

A furnace heat exchanger test is a crucial part of maintaining the efficiency and safety of a heating system. The heat exchanger in a furnace is responsible for transferring heat from the combustion process to the air that circulates through your home. Over time, heat exchangers can develop cracks or damage, which can lead to a variety of issues such as reduced efficiency, increased energy bills, and even potential health hazards.

One of the main reasons to conduct a furnace heat exchanger test is to ensure the safety of your home and family. A damaged heat exchanger can cause carbon monoxide to leak into your home, which can be extremely dangerous. Carbon monoxide is odorless and colorless, making it impossible to detect without the proper equipment. By conducting a heat exchanger test, you can identify any issues with your furnace before they become a serious safety hazard.

In addition to safety concerns, a damaged heat exchanger can also lead to reduced efficiency and increased energy bills. When a heat exchanger is cracked or damaged, it can cause the furnace to work harder to produce the same amount of heat. This can result in higher energy bills and unnecessary wear and tear on your heating system. By conducting a heat exchanger test, you can identify and address any issues early on to ensure that your furnace is operating at its optimal efficiency.

There are several different methods for conducting a furnace heat exchanger test, depending on the type of furnace you have and the age of the system. One common method is to visually inspect the heat exchanger for any signs of damage, such as cracks or corrosion. This can be done by removing the access panel on your furnace and examining the heat exchanger closely. However, not all issues are visible to the naked eye, which is why it is important to also perform a more thorough test using specialized equipment.

One common method for testing a furnace heat exchanger is to use a combustion analyzer to measure the levels of carbon monoxide and oxygen in the flue gases. This can help you identify any issues with the heat exchanger that may not be visible during a visual inspection. Another method is to perform a pressure test, which involves pressurizing the heat exchanger with air or nitrogen to check for leaks. These more advanced tests can provide a more comprehensive evaluation of the health of your furnace heat exchanger.
